Picture Frame and Artwork Alignment

Have you ever spent an hour hanging a gallery wall, only to step back and realize everything looks slightly askew? It’s maddening, isn’t it? A laser level eliminates this frustration entirely. Project a perfectly horizontal line across your wall, and suddenly hanging multiple frames becomes as easy as connecting dots. Mirror and Shelf Installation

Installing shelves without a laser level is like trying to cut a straight line blindfolded. Sure, you might get lucky, but why leave it to chance? With a laser level, you can ensure your floating shelves actually float level, not at that subtle angle that makes everything placed on them slide to one corner.

Mirrors present their own challenges, especially large ones. A crooked mirror doesn’t just look bad – it can make an entire room feel off-balance. Laser levels help you position mirrors perfectly, whether you’re creating a feature wall or simply hanging a bathroom mirror that won’t make you question your reflection every morning.

Theatrical and Entertainment Production

The entertainment industry has embraced laser levels for applications ranging from set construction to lighting design. Theater productions use them to ensure set pieces align correctly and that sight lines remain consistent across different venue configurations.

Film and television productions rely on laser levels for continuity. When shooting scenes out of sequence, laser levels help ensure that props, furniture, and set pieces return to exactly the same positions. This attention to detail prevents continuity errors that could require expensive reshoots.

Accessibility Modifications

When installing accessibility ramps, handrails, or other modifications, precision isn’t just about appearance – it’s about compliance with safety codes and ensuring usability for people with mobility challenges. Laser levels help ensure that ramps maintain proper gradients and that handrails follow consistent heights and angles.

These applications require particular attention to detail because the end users depend on the precision for their safety and independence. A handrail that varies in height or a ramp with an inconsistent gradient can create hazardous conditions.

Camping and Outdoor Recreation Setup

Serious campers and RV enthusiasts use laser levels to ensure their setups are properly level. A level RV not only feels more comfortable but also ensures that appliances like refrigerators operate correctly. Camping setups benefit from level platforms for tents and properly aligned cooking areas.
